IELTS Reading Academic Test - this includes three long texts which range from the descriptive and factual to the discursive and analytical. These are taken from books, journals, magazines and newspapers. They have been selected for a non-specialist audience but are appropriate for people entering university courses or seeking …

WebSample test questions. There are two types of IELTS test to choose from, IELTS Academic or IELTS General Training. All test takers take the same Listening and Speaking tests but different Reading and Writing tests. Make sure that you prepare for the correct version of the test. WebIf you choose to take the Computer-based IELTS, you will take the Listening, Reading and Writing tests using a computer. The Speaking test is face-to-face with an examiner, as we believe it is the most effective way of assessing your speaking skills and prompts a more lifelike performance.
